2013-02-25 10 views
6

ho installato python API di visualizzazione Google nel mio virtualenv conCosa metto in requisiti pip file per un pacchetto non in PyPI

pip install -U -f http://code.google.com/p/google-visualization-python/ gviz-api-py 

cosa ho bisogno di mettere nel file di requirements.txt pip in modo che Heroku può scaricarlo e installarlo?

+1

Hai provato 'PIP installare http://google-visualization-python.googlecode.com/files/gviz_api_py -1.8.2.tar.gz'? – arulmr

+0

@arulmr scopre che eri molto vicino. Non ho notato che puoi inserire l'url come richiesto. testo. questo è il file dei requisiti che ha funzionato. – derdo

+1

Inserisci 'git + git: // github.com/google/google-visualization-python.git' in requirements.txt. Ha lavorato per me su Heroku. –

risposta

-1

Secondo messaggio di errore

Ottenere gviz-api.py da svn + http://google-visualization-python.googlecode.com/svn/[email protected]#egg=gviz_api.py-1.8.2-py2.7-dev_r26 (da requirements.txt -r (linea 6)) Check-out http://google-visualization-python.googlecode.com/svn/trunk (a revisione 26) per ./.heroku/ src/gviz-api.py non riesci a trovare il comando 'svn'

addirittura non il comando svn permesso.

In questo caso, ottenere il codice sorgente da googlecode nella directory del progetto e aggiungere .svn in .gitignore. O creare fork su github e lavorare con esso.

Ma prima clonazione di github leggere http://www.apache.org/licenses/LICENSE-2.0 Io non so è che consentono tali movimenti.

1

provare a utilizzare il seguente nel requirements.txt:

-e svn+http://google-visualization-python.googlecode.com/svn/trunk#egg=google-visualization-python 

O

-e svn+http://google-visualization-python.googlecode.com/svn/[email protected]#egg=gviz_api.py-1.8.2-py2.7-dev_r26 

Informazioni sui installing from VCS utilizzando pip.

+0

heroku dire "Impossibile trovare il comando" svn'' – nk9

+0

Assicurati che heroku supporti svn. Meglio contattare il supporto di heroku per ottenere maggiori informazioni su di esso. – arulmr

0

Questo dovrebbe farlo:

https://github.com/google/google-visualization-python/zipball/master 

Questo installerà gviz-apy.py

Problemi correlati